Addressing Student Concerns
Common Student Questions: "Is any AI use cheating?"Not necessarily. The key is transparency and appropriateness. Using AI for grammar checking is like using spell-check. Using AI to write your analysis is like having someone else complete your assignment.
"What if AI makes my writing too good?"Good writing is always welcome. The concern is whether the ideas and analysis are authentically yours. Can you explain and defend your arguments in person?
"My professor says I can't use AI at all. Is this fair?"Professors have the right to set assignment parameters. Some skills require development without technological assistance, just as math students must learn arithmetic before using calculators.
"How do I know if my writing sounds too AI-like?"Read your work aloud. Does it sound like your voice? Can you explain every sentence and idea? Have you included personal insights and connections?

Conclusion
The integration of AI in academic writing represents both an opportunity and a challenge. As educators, our role is not to eliminate technology but to guide students in using it ethically and effectively while developing irreplaceable human capabilities.
The future of academic writing lies not in choosing between human and artificial intelligence, but in fostering the uniquely human skills of critical thinking, creativity, and authentic expression while leveraging AI as a powerful tool for enhancement and support.
